Compartments the compartmentalization has advantages in efficiency and specialization, and defense. Do not memorize all of these names. It is efficient to translate protein one place then move them. Proteins need to get into the membrane in the cell. Most er proteins are targeted there during translation. The proteins have a signal sequence, which is recognized by a soluble protein that then helps to take it to the er. The signal sequence is cleaved once the protein enters the er. Signal sequence tells the protein where to go.
